Document Transport — Print Shop Master Copies

Quick guide for moving master copies to Bramblehurst Print Co. These are the only originals, so treat the run like a valuables transfer, not a regular parcel drop. Use the red tamper-evident envelopes from the supply shelf, log the seal number in the transport book, and never combine the run with general mail. The masters go directly to the press supervisor, nobody else. On arrival, the courier must follow the hand-over instruction stated below.

drop instructions, kajep-tageg: the kasvan casdor courier leaves the quenvan quenox druox ledger at gate 4316 under passcode 799004

**14:32** — The Fernvale kiosk watchdog started bouncing the shell app every ninety seconds, which, yeah, was our fault: a plugin manifest change made the heartbeat file land in the wrong directory. Plugin folks, double-check your manifest paths against the v2 schema. We confirmed the misbehaving deployment by matching it to the build token below.

pipeline stamp: htk9_6ce9d33c5

Handover for the records team, end of Tuesday shift. The full pallet of recalled Voltarra V2 chargers has been counted, shrink-wrapped, and tagged with the red recall labels per the Fennick Depot procedure. Count sheet is signed twice and filed in the recall binder, drawer three. Keldway Reclaim will send a courier Thursday morning to remove the pallet from bay six; their paperwork must match our tally before release. Please log the collection time in the recall register. The confidential courier hand-over instruction follows below.

drop instructions, fawig-bawig: the kasael norwyn courier leaves the casath ledger at gate 6800 under passcode 939668

## TICKET: Config drift — Spanview large-file diff viewer

Welcome, new folks — this is a good starter ticket. Spanview is our diff viewer for large files on the Harkness code-review platform. Production's chunking and memory limits have drifted from what's checked into the config repo; someone bumped them manually when the Oslett monorepo diffs started timing out. We need to decide whether to codify the live values or roll them back. For reference, the values currently running in production are captured below.

deployment values, kajep-kageg:
[praix]
host = praix.paliqcorp.corp
user = praix_svc
database = praix_prod